BBEP Student Completes Summer Internship with Seven Source
This summer, La'Nyah Biggs, a Business Management student at Southern University, was awarded a scholarship and secured a summer internship through the Black Building Envelope Professionals (BBEP). She interned with Seven Source, where she gained hands-on experience with building envelope technology, including job site visits and product demonstrations. La'Nyah also explored the innovative world of 3D printed concrete by PIKUS3D. After graduation, she aspires to become a CEO. BBEP is committed to supporting underrepresented groups in the building envelope industry and introducing HBCU students to construction opportunities.
